May 21, 2008, 2:18 a.m.For those of you who have yet to see "Cinema Paradiso" I can only say SEE IT!
Allow me to quickly summarize this wonderful film. In a small town in Italy a young boy befriends a grumpy old projectionist. The village priest attends a private screening of every film to be shown, ringing a bell at every kiss, indicating that the projectionist is to remove these "offending" bits from the film. Years, well, a lifetime later the projectionist has died and the young boy, now a filmmaker himself, has been willed a cannister of film. He gives it to a projectionist and sits alone watching...
As all those stolen kisses play out on the screen before him. Kiss after kiss after kiss, comic, tragic, lusty, romantic. It's the perfect ending and simply put the most beautiful and romantic and just plain HUMAN moment in the history of film. I hope you love this scene as much as I do.
